一个外盒子里有三个内盒子,可是我的第二个第三个盒子不在外盒子里面

一个外盒子里有三个内盒子,可是我的第二个第三个盒子不在外盒子里面

该回答引用NewBing

你好,这是Bing。我可以帮你解决CSS问题。😊


根据CSS基础框盒模型①,每个HTML元素都可以看作一个矩形的盒子,包括外边距、边框、内边距和内容区域。你可以用CSS属性来控制这些盒子的大小、位置和样式。


如果你想让三个内盒子都在外盒子里面,你可能需要检查以下几点:

  • 外盒子的宽度是否足够容纳三个内盒子的宽度(包括边框和内边距)。
  • 内盒子的浮动(float)或定位(position)属性是否影响了它们在外盒子里的排列。
  • 外盒子是否有清除浮动(clear)或设置溢出(overflow)属性来防止内部元素溢出。

源: 与必应的对话, 2023/3/22

该回答引用于gpt与OKX安生共同编写:
  • 该回答引用于gpt与OKX安生共同编写:

如果您在编写 HTML 和 CSS 时遇到了这种情况,可能是因为您的布局出现了问题。以下是一些可能导致这种情况发生的原因和解决方案:

    1. 检查元素的位置和尺寸:请确保三个内盒子都正确地嵌套在外盒子内,并且它们的位置和尺寸没有超出或重叠。
    1. 检查盒模型属性:请确保所有元素的 box-sizing 属性设置正确,以控制它们的尺寸计算方式。通常建议将 box-sizing 设置为 border-box,可以更好地控制边框和内边距对尺寸的影响。
    1. 使用 flexbox 或 grid 布局:如果您使用的是传统的浮动或定位布局,可能会很难控制元素的位置和大小。建议使用 flexbox 或 grid 布局,它们提供了更强大和灵活的布局工具,可以轻松地实现各种复杂布局。
    1. 检查 CSS 属性值:如果您在编写 CSS 时不小心设置了错误的属性值,可能会导致元素的位置和大小出现问题。请仔细检查您的代码,并确保所有值都设置正确。

如有帮助望请给个采纳哦~